How to stop pipes from freezing during the winter
All property owners that live in temperate environments need to do their best to winterize their pipelines. Failure to do so can mean calamity like frozen, split, or ruptured pipelines.

Turn On the Faucets


When the temperature level drops as well as it appears as if the freezing temperature will certainly last, it will certainly help to switch on your water both inside and outdoors. This will certainly keep the water streaming via your plumbing systems. Additionally, the activity will certainly slow down the freezing process. Significantly, there's no demand to turn it on full blast. You'll end up throwing away gallons of water by doing this. Rather, go for about 5 decreases per min.

Open Up Closet Doors Hiding Plumbing


When it's chilly outside, it would certainly be helpful to open up cabinet doors that are camouflaging your pipelines. For example, they could be someplace in your kitchen or washroom. This will allow the warm air from your heater to flow there. As a result, you prevent these exposed pipes from freezing. Doing this small trick can keep your pipes warm and limit the potentially dangerous end results of freezing temperatures.

Shut Off Water When Pipelines are Frozen


If you observe that your pipelines are entirely frozen or almost nearing that stage, transform off the main water valve right away. You will normally locate this in your cellar or laundry room near the heating system or the front wall closest to the street. Transform it off right now to stop more damages.
Do not neglect to shut exterior water resources, also, such as your connection for the yard residence. Doing this will stop extra water from filling out your plumbing system. With even more water, even more ice will certainly pile up, which will eventually lead to burst pipelines. 10 Things People Unknowingly Do That Can Ruin Plumbing System


Disregarding the Limitations of Your Garbage Disposal


Many people fail to understand that garbage disposal is not a substitute for a trash can. You should never put down things like potato, onion peels and coffee grounds in the drain. These things can either ruin the blades of the garbage disposal or result in a clog in the drain.


Flushing Things in the Toilet


Are you conveniently flushing tissue paper, cotton swabs or hygiene products? You need to STOP doing this with immediate effect!


The toilet is meant only to flush pee and poop. Never flush other things down because they will eventually clog your drain or sewer. This rule applies to things which we claim to be biodegradable too.


Failing to Winter-Proof Your Plumbing


Do you face frequent pipe bursts in the winter season? It may be out of your own fault rather than nature’s spell on your plumbing.


Always remember to disconnect all outdoor hoses and pipe connections before winter approaches to save the pipes from freezing. You may even need to get your plumbing insulated to save it from extremely cold temperatures.


Ignoring the Condition of Your Dishwasher and Washing Machine Hoses


Most hoses for dishwashers and washing machines wear out soon after 5-6 years of use. Unfortunately, a worn-out hose bursts suddenly without much prior warning signs. It’s advisable to replace the hoses every 5 years to prevent sudden unexpected mishaps.
